Eddie Wigfall Obituary

UNION CITY, Ga. -- Mr. Eddie Wigfall passed into rest Sunday, August 9, 2015, at his residence. He was the son of the late Catherine and Kenneth Wigfall and attended school in Bulloch County, Georgia. Eddie was married to the late Jean Wigfall and moved to New Jersey in the early 60s. He worked at Whippany Paper Mill during the 70s and retired from Orange Garden Supply in Orange, N.J., in 2003 and later moved to Atlanta, Ga., in 2005.
Eddie enjoyed cooking, gardening, playing cards, watching old westerns and spending time with his children, grandchildren and other family and friends.
Eddie leaves to cherish his memory: five daughters, Jeanine Miller–Dennis, Patricia Wigfall-Petty, Roseanne Wigfall, Marilyn Wigfall and Michelle Crockett; two sons, Terry Wigfall and John Wigfall; three sons-in-law, Alan Dennis, Roy Petty, Kenneth Ricks; one daughter-in-law, Tamera Smith-Wigfall; 15 grandchildren, Stacey, Anthony, Alan, Ashley, Kendra, Kyle, Roy, Kenneth, Wesley, Ikeiyah, Brandon, Imani, Eron, Ebony and Taijhun; three great-grandchildren, Gracie, Zoe and Vincent; one sister, Thelma (Robert) Armstrong, Register, Ga.; one brother, Thomas Wigfall, Statesboro, Ga.; and one aunt, Mamie Cewanie–Mincey, South Bend, Ind.; a host of n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ends.
The body will lie in state for one hour prior to the service. There will be no viewing after the eulogy.
The funeral service for Mr. Wigfall will be held at 1 p.m. Friday, August 21, 2015, at the New Bethlehem Baptist Church, Register, Ga., with the Rev. Michael Moore, pastor, officiating. Burial will be in the church cemetery.
